Texas Tech suspends Mike Leach
Texas Tech has suspended head coach Mike Leach following a complaint from a player and his parents regarding his treatment of the athlete following an injury.

Below is a press release from the University.

<snip>

Press release

STATEMENT FROM TEXAS TECH ON SUSPENSION OF FOOTBALL COACH MIKE LEACH

Texas Tech University recently received a complaint from a player and his parents regarding Red Raider Head Football Coach Mike Leach’s treatment of the athlete after an injury.

At Texas Tech all such complaints are considered as serious matters, and as a result, an investigation of the incident is underway. Until the investigation is complete, Texas Tech University is suspending coach Leach from all duties as Head Football Coach effective immediately. The investigation into this matter will continue in a thorough and fair manner.

Coach Ruffin McNeill will assume duties as Interim Head Coach and will coach the team during the Alamo Bowl.

5. Here is the allegation -- if true it is pretty serious I think
Texas Tech Coach Mike Leach was suspended for the Alamo Bowl by Texas Tech today. The decision to suspend Mike Leach from the Alamo Bowl stems from a player complaint that filed by player Adam James. It seems that the school is taking the claims very seriously, and it using the time during the Mike Leach suspension in order to do some investigating. They must also find some credence behind the claims, because this is a very big move to make less than a week from an important bowl game.

In the complaint against Texas Tech Coach Mike Leach, the player is claiming that he was mis-treated while trying to recover from a concussion that he sustained on December 16th. An ESPN source is quoted as stating that Leach told a trainer to "put James in the darkest, tightest spot. It was in an electrical closet, again, with a guard posted outside." This followed a statement that Leach told a trainer to move James "to the darkest place, to clean out the equipment and to make sure that he could not sit or lean. He was confined for three hours."

The argument from the other side is that James was placed in an equipment room because it was much cooler and darker than the practice field. The Texas Tech suspension seems very harsh, unless they have some concrete proof that Leach did indeed force the player into a closet and post a guard outside the door to not allow him to come out. If Leach did what is alleged, it would not have been a smart move at all, because the father of Adam Jones actually works for ESPN (Craig James).
